认识编程语

  1.认识编程语言

1.什么是编程语言呢?

  1. 定义:与计算机交流的一种方式(定义计算机程序的形式)
  2. 源由:谈谈编程语言的发展历史
    1. 最开始是没有编程这个概念的,最开始都是叫"计算机语言",后面随着语言的发展,编程这个概念更能体现计算机语言的作用,慢慢我们改口叫"编程语言"了
    2. 谈谈到"编程语言"自然要谈"计算机的发展历史了"因为这两者是相辅相成的,了解了计算机的发展,也就自然能认识编程语言及理解它在计算机中的作用
      1. 计算机之父与它思想(至今都是按照这个套路来制造计算机的)
        1. 约翰-冯诺依曼
        2. 思想
          1. 数字计算机采用二进制传递与处理数据
          2. 计算机按照程序顺序执行
        3. 硬件主要组成
          1. 运算器,控制器,存储器,输入设备与输出设备
      2. 第一代:电子管数字机(1946-1958):使用机器,汇编语言
      3. 第二代:晶体管数字机(1958—1964年):汇编与高级语言
      4. 第三代:集成电路数字机(1964-1970):汇编语言,高级语言(第一个面向对象语言诞生(simula)
      5. 第四代:大规则集成电路机(1970-至今):主要高级语言(java,c,c#...)
      6. 总结
        1. 由于集成技术的发展,可以把运算器和控制器都集中在一个芯片上、从而出现了微处理器,最后现在PC就诞生了
        2. 速度越来越快,体积越来越小,价格越来越便宜,语言越来越高级

2.编程语言的作用?

  1. 与计算机交流
  2. 具体点
    1. 你电脑的操作系统,手机操作系统是由编程语言写的(c,c++)
    2. 你电脑上安装的各种软件,手机上各种APP也是由编程语言写的(c,c++,java)

3.如何学习使用编程语言

    

1.前提是你要感兴趣,如果只是觉得这个行业挣钱容易,我劝你不要来(年轻人,你是被培训机构忽悠了),挣钱都不容易(付出总比收获多,这个行业更是如此!)
2.有兴趣,然后坚持学下去,学以致用,你会感到快乐的,把这当作一种爱好而不是谋生的手段(当然这也可以是它的附加价值)
3.全世界的人都差不多,但是人与人之间沟通的方式有千万种(语言千万种),同理人与计算机沟通也一样,选择流行的并掌握好它,我们就能使用了
4.掌握一种后,如果需要学习其它编程语言,那是相当容易的(语言是相通的,编程语言也一样)

原文地址:https://www.cnblogs.com/River111/p/9523082.html